Share of women graduating from STEM programs in tertiary education in Brazil
Brazil: Share of women graduating from STEM programs in tertiary education was 36.64 in 2017. βΌ Falling
Share of women graduating from STEM programs in tertiary education in Brazil, 2001β2017
Source: UNESCO via World Bank β processed by Our World in Data.
Analysis
In 2017, share of women graduating from stem programs in tertiary education in Brazil stood at 36.64.
That represents a change of up 4.1% on the previous year and up 11.4% over ten years.
Over the whole period, share of women graduating from stem programs in tertiary education in Brazil peaked at 37.94 in 2001 and was at its lowest, 30.61, in 2010.
Brazil ranks 36th of 96 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 15 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 35.38 | 32.16 | 37.94 | 8 |
| 2010s | 33.68 | 30.61 | 36.64 | 7 |
